a,a:hover,button,button:hover,input,input:hover{text-decoration:none}.f_btn,a:focus,button:focus,input:focus{outline:0}::-webkit-scrollbar{width:8px}.progress-wrap,.progress-wrap::after{-webkit-transition:.2s linear;width:46px;height:46px;display:block;cursor:pointer}::-webkit-scrollbar-thumb{background-color:#aaa}::-webkit-scrollbar-track{background-color:#f1f1f1}:root{--primary-color:#1e73be}b,h1,h2,h3,h4,h5,h6,strong{font-weight:700!important}.progress-wrap{position:fixed;z-index:10000;opacity:0;visibility:hidden;transform:translateY(15px);transition:.2s linear;bottom:30px;border-radius:46px;background-color:#fff;box-shadow:inset 0 0 0 2px #ccc}.progress-wrap.active-progress{opacity:1;visibility:visible;transform:translateY(0)}.progress-wrap::after{top:0;left:0;z-index:1;text-align:center;position:absolute;font-family:'Font Awesome 6 Pro';transition:.2s linear;color:#1f2029;font-size:24px;content:'\f341';line-height:46px}.progress-wrap svg path{fill:none}.progress-wrap svg.progress-circle path{box-sizing:border-box;-webkit-transition:.2s linear;transition:.2s linear;stroke:#1f2029;stroke-width:2px}.progress-wrap.btn-left-side{left:30px}.progress-wrap.btn-right-side{right:30px}.progress-wrap:hover::after{color:#1f2029}#header{padding:5px 0;background:#fff}#header .logo_area img{height:70px}#header .title-page{font-weight:700;color:var(--primary-color);margin:0}.btn-primary{color:#fff;background-color:#0d6efd!important;border-color:#0d6efd!important}.btn{padding:.375rem .75rem!important}.counter{background-color:#f5f5f5;padding:20px 0;border-radius:5px}.fa-2x{margin:0 auto;float:none;display:table;color:#4ad1e5}.count-text,.count-title{font-weight:400;margin-top:10px;margin-bottom:0;text-align:center}.count-title{font-size:40px}.count-text{font-size:13px}.f_btn,span{font-size:1.25rem}.step{width:1rem;height:.75rem;display:inline-block}.step:not(:last-child){margin-right:3rem}.step.active,.step.finish{background-color:#ffc533!important}.f_btn:hover,body{background-color:#fff}.form_items li input,.multisteps_form_panel{display:none}.question_number{padding-top:1rem}.question_title h2{padding:20px;border-radius:10px;font-weight:700;font-size:25px}span{color:#fff;font-weight:700;padding-bottom:1rem;-webkit-transition:.8s cubic-bezier(.25, 1, .5, 1);transition:.8s cubic-bezier(.25, 1, .5, 1)}.f_btn,h1{color:#000a38}h1{font-size:4.204375rem}.form_items li{width:100%;color:#000a38;font-size:1.2125rem;padding:13px 50px;margin-top:12px;position:relative;cursor:pointer}.form_items li:after{content:"";width:1.7rem;height:1.7rem;top:50%;left:14px;-webkit-transform:translateY(-50%);transform:translateY(-50%);position:absolute;border-radius:100%;border:2px solid #e2e2e2}.form_items li:before{content:"";top:50%;left:18px;-webkit-transform:translateY(-50%);transform:translateY(-50%);position:absolute;color:#ffc533;font-size:1.2rem;font-weight:900;font-family:"Font Awesome 6 Pro";display:none}.form_items li label{cursor:pointer}.form_items li.active:before{display:block}.f_btn{font-weight:800;padding:.9375rem 1.5625rem;background-color:#ffc533;margin-right:.625rem;margin-bottom:2rem;-webkit-transition:.8s cubic-bezier(.25, 1, .5, 1);transition:.8s cubic-bezier(.25, 1, .5, 1)}.f_btn:hover{color:#ffc533}body{width:100%;min-height:100vh;background-image:-webkit-gradient(linear,left top,right top,from(rgba(38,142,255,.8)),to(rgba(91,117,255,.7))),url(../images/bg_0.png);background-image:linear-gradient(to right,rgba(38,142,255,.8),rgba(91,117,255,.7)),url(../images/bg_0.png);background-repeat:no-repeat;background-position:center right;background-size:cover;color:#000;font-size:16px;font-weight:400;line-height:1.65;font-style:normal;font-display:swap}a,button,input{cursor:pointer}ul>li{list-style:none}h1,h2,h3,h4,h5,h6{font-weight:700}img{max-width:100%;height:auto}.animate_50ms{-webkit-animation-delay:50ms;animation-delay:50ms}.animate_100ms{-webkit-animation-delay:.1s;animation-delay:.1s}.animate_150ms{-webkit-animation-delay:150ms;animation-delay:150ms}.animate_200ms{-webkit-animation-delay:.2s;animation-delay:.2s}.animate_250ms{-webkit-animation-delay:250ms;animation-delay:250ms}@media (min-width:1500px){.container{max-width:1510px}}@media screen and (max-width:1499.98px){.step_progress .step{width:12rem}.step_progress .step:not(:last-child){margin-right:2.8rem}}@media screen and (max-width:1399.98px){.step_progress .step{width:12rem}.step_progress .step:not(:last-child){margin-right:2.8rem}span{font-size:1.2rem;padding-bottom:.8rem}h1{font-size:4rem}.form_items li{font-size:1.2rem;padding:.8375rem 3rem}.f_btn{font-size:1.18rem;font-weight:700;padding:.7375rem 1.3625rem}}@media screen and (max-width:1199.98px){.f_btn,span{font-size:1.15rem}.step_progress .step{width:10rem}.step_progress .step:not(:last-child){margin-right:2.6rem}span{padding-bottom:.6rem}h1{font-size:3.5rem}.form_items li{font-size:1rem;padding:.7375rem 3rem}.f_btn{font-weight:700;padding:.8375rem 1.4625rem}}@media screen and (max-width:991px){.f_btn,.form_items li,span{font-size:1rem}.f_btn,h1{font-weight:600}.step_progress .step{width:6.5rem}.step_progress .step:not(:last-child){margin-right:2rem}h1{font-size:3.5rem}.f_btn{padding:.7375rem 1.3625rem}}@media screen and (max-width:767px){.f_btn,h1{font-weight:500}body{overflow-y:scroll}#header .title-page{font-size:25px;line-height:32px}#header .logo_area img{height:70px;margin:auto;display:block}.question_title h2{font-size:20px}.f_btn,.form_items li,span{font-size:.8rem}.question-images img{width:100%}.step_progress .step{width:5rem}.step_progress .step:not(:last-child){margin-right:1.5rem}h1{font-size:2.5rem}.f_btn{padding:.5375rem 1.1625rem}}@media screen and (max-width:575px){span{font-size:.8rem}h1{font-size:2rem;font-weight:500}.f_btn{font-size:.6rem;padding:.5375rem 1.1625rem}}.div-white-border{background:#fff;padding:10px;border-radius:10px}input.required{border-color:red}.question-images{text-align:center;margin:0 0 20px}.question-images img{width:300px}.form_items ul{margin:0!important}.pull-right{float:right}ul.unordered-list{margin:0}@media only screen and (min-width:1440px){.container,.grid-container{max-width:1510px!important}}.thangdiem_images{width:100%;margin-bottom: 20px}